Cowboy Butter Lobster Tails

Description

This easy recipe features grilled lobster tails basted in a flavorful cowboy butter sauce made with herbs, garlic, and spices for a mouthwatering meal.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 4 lobster tails (about 6 ounces each)
  • 1/2 cup unsalted butter, softened
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 tablespoon fresh parsley, chopped
  • 1 teaspoon smoked paprika
  • 1/2 teaspoon red pepper flakes
  • 1 tablespoon lemon juice
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• Lemon wedges, for serving

Instructions

  1. Preheat your grill to medium-high heat.
  2. In a bowl, mix together the softened butter, minced garlic, chopped parsley, smoked paprika, red pepper flakes, lemon juice, salt, and pepper to create the cowboy butter.
  3. Using kitchen shears, cut the top shell of each lobster tail lengthwise and loosen the meat from the shell, but keep it attached at the base.
  4. Brush the cowboy butter generously over the lobster meat.
  5. Place the lobster tails on the grill, meat side up, and cook for 5-7 minutes, basting with more butter halfway through.
  6. Once the meat is opaque and firm, remove from the grill.
  7. Serve immediately with lemon wedges.

Notes

For a spicier version, increase the red pepper flakes. Ensure lobster is fresh for the best flavor.
